Up for sale is a great little Volkswagen "THING". It it white in color  with black interior and top. It has 23,453 miles and originally came from Georgia. We have owned this car since 2003 and we got it partially disassembled with a bunch of extra parts included. It is a complete car that is running and driving, and quite a barrel of fun to take out for a cruise. If not from just the pleasurable ride but all the looks and comments are great. Overall it is in good condition and has had a lot of work done to it but there is still a few things that should be done if you want to restore it,but as a driver its great.


Things it could use would be shocks, front ball joints, a fresh paint job if desired and a new top if you so desire. The roll bar and top are currently off of the car, but will be coming with the car as the top material is not in the best condition. A replacement top can be purchased for roughly $600 dollars but that may have changed since I last checked. The ball joints are not expensive and I believe you could get shocks for $100-150 for all four. It has a small oil leak somewhere around the engine transmission area as seen in the pictures, but we have not investigated that yet. However it does not use oil, just leaks a little, probably as seals will seep a little over time when they aren't used much.  What old car doesn't need tinkered with a little here and there?

This great little car has just been a pleasure car since we have owned it and has not seen bad weather which has been a benefit to its current condition. As I said before, we purchased this car with 22,181 miles on it and it was partially disassembled. The 1600cc engine had been removed but was complete and the engine was checked over before being re-installed to make sure it was ok and still usable. Over time it has had a bunch of other items taken care of on it so that it remained a safe and good driver. These items are as follows in no particular order: new windshield and rubber surround; brake shoes, master cylinder, one wheel cylinder and emergency brake cable; new battery and regulator; the engine got new plugs, wires, points, condenser, belt and oil pressure sending unit; its had a new exhaust system installed; its had the front wheel bearings replaced; new floor pans installed; new shifter assembly and boot; new front seat belts and a new ignition switch. So mechanically it is in good condition and has been well taken care of. The tires are in great condition and the body was undercoated at one point in time before we owned it. There are no major rust issues, just two minor spots and a tiny bit of surface rust. All of which could be easily repaired or as I said, just driven as a fun car. The pictures will show these.

Also it comes with an extra engine,(condition unknown), a couple of other boxes of miscellaneous parts, and a tow bar. The spare tire and wheel are missing though.

VW confirms new TDI for second half of 2014 in Golf, Jetta, Passat and Beetle

Tue, 18 Mar 2014

Diesel lovers rejoice. Volkswagen is bringing the latest iteration of its 2.0-liter four-cylinder diesel engine - dubbed the EA288 - to the 2015 model year Golf, Jetta, Passat, Beetle (2013 model pictured above) and Beetle Convertible, and the cars will be on sale in the second half of 2014.
While it shares its moniker with the old diesel, the new engine produces 150 horsepower, a 10-hp boost, and 236 pound-feet of torque. VW promises improved fuel economy as well, but it hasn't announced specifically what amount yet. The company claims that despite the same displacement, only the bore spacing is shared with the previous version. The mill includes new features like exhaust gas recirculation, an intercooler integrated into the intake manifold and low-friction camshaft bearings.
VW Group of America has had great success with diesels in the US recently. Vee-Dub and Audi sold 105,899 diesel-equipped models in 2013. It was the first time the group ever sold over 100,000 diesels in a year, and they accounted for 24 percent of sales. Scroll down to read the full press release about the announcement.

J.D. Power customer survey of dealers counts Cadillac, Buick as big winners

Mon, 14 Apr 2014

Cadillac and Buick have taken the trophies in J.D. Power's latest Customer Service Index Study examining satisfaction with dealer service. Surveying more than 90,000 owners and lessees of 2009-2013 model-year cars, the study found that those with pre-paid maintenance packages were ten percent more likely to buy their next car from the same brand.
Dealer satisfaction scores have improved overall, Cadillac nabbed the luxury segment ahead of Audi and Lexus, taking the crown that Lexus held last year. Buick keeps the mass-market dealer satisfaction win in the family, finishing ahead of Volkswagen and last year's winner GMC. The study also found that service department use of tablets increased customer satisfaction, as did "best practices" like "providing helpful advice." Who knew?
